First, a vital piece of information for potential travelers: Whinhill does not boast a ticket office or machine. This means planning ahead and purchasing your tickets online would be the most convenient option. Conveniently, if you choose to use smartcards, there are validators on-site to make your journey smoother.
While the station lacks a traditional structure of amenities such as toilets and refreshment facilities, it compensates with essential accessibility features. It’s a Category B station, with partial step-free access. However, bear in mind there are temporary issues with the entrance ramp. For those needing assistance, reaching out to ScotRail's Assisted Travel team is recommended. Remember, the station lacks real-time staffing, so make use of the help points strategically placed to avail of any assistance you might require.
If you're wondering how you might continue your journey from Whinhill, you'll be pleased to know that the station is well-connected with various transport links. There are bus services available for local travel that pick up and drop off near the station entrance, or you can opt for taxi services, which can be arranged through resources like TrainTaxi. You can also find more detailed information about local bus services by visiting Traveline Scotland’s website or contacting their 24-hour service line.

Manchester Piccadilly expertly caters to passenger needs with a variety of facilities. The ticket office operates diligently from as early as 4:30 am to 10:30 pm through the week, ensuring you can grab a ticket for those early morning travels. For those tech-savvy commuters, ticket machines are readily available and accessible, allowing smooth online ticket collection. The station is well-equipped for accessibility; offering step-free access, ramps, and tactile warning strips for the visually impaired make it a user-friendly place for all travelers.
The station boasts free public Wi-Fi, ATM machines, and a plethora of shops and dining options. Coffee lovers will appreciate the numerous kiosks, while those in need of essentials can visit the mini supermarkets and pharmacies located within the station. The station even went the extra mile to ensure comfort by providing lounges, including a 1st Class Lounge and an Assisted Travel Lounge, making it an amenable waiting experience.
Getting to and from Manchester Piccadilly is a breeze with its robust transport links. Metrolink trams connect you to key destinations like Bury, Rochdale, and Manchester Airport, among others. For those preferring buses, a network of frequent local services are operated by 'First' and 'Stagecoach'. There's also a free bus service that runs every ten minutes around the city center—a convenient option for quick city hops.
The taxi rank located at the Fairfield Street exit offers service between 2 am to 5 am, giving you round-the-clock availability. If you're looking to explore the city on two wheels, Brompton bicycles are available for hire with two flexible tariffs. Additionally, if you're embarking on a flight, Manchester International Airport is just 9-10 miles away with several direct train services throughout the day. Car hire agents are also a short walk from the station, providing flexibility in travel.
